- ETH Zurich researchers, spearheaded by physicist Rachel Grange, have unveiled an innovative, budget-friendly technique for crafting ultra-thin metalenses from lithium niobate. This groundbreaking soft nanoimprinting method harnesses nonlinear optical effects, such as second-harmonic generation, promising to transform optics across electronics, imaging, and anti-counterfeiting, and democratizing access to precision optics.
